| 13 Aug 2025 |
emily | well | 18:02:42 |
emily | I really doubt that the two module sets will completely compress into nothing | 18:02:50 |
emily | kernel versions do famously change things in modules | 18:02:57 |
emily | but I'd hope it'd be a non-trivial improvement | 18:03:14 |
emily | ideally we'd get them to be interleaved in the cpio… | 18:03:22 |
emily | so that you have one version of a module right after the other version | 18:03:27 |
emily | then it'd compress better | 18:03:35 |
emily | think you can do that ElvishJerricco? :P | 18:03:40 |
ElvishJerricco | I mean at that point we better take the erofs initrd patch and just let erofs do the fancy dedupe | 18:03:54 |
emily | yeah | 18:03:59 |
K900 | @emily I am big computering | 18:04:07 |
K900 | It's honestly not even a terrible number of rebuilds | 18:04:19 |
emily | https://clickhole.com/the-future-is-now-google-has-confirmed-that-its-comput-1825121342/ | 18:04:25 |
emily | yeah I guess on Linux LLVM is just Rust and Mesa | 18:04:33 |
emily | I'm too used to Darwin | 18:04:40 |
emily | where of course touching LLVM kills you instantly | 18:04:46 |
emily | I didn't even check the syntax of my C++ modifications btw. sorry | 18:04:55 |
emily | furthemore… uh… KDE? | 18:05:48 |
emily | oh yeah DrKonqi depends on GDB | 18:05:54 |
emily | I assume that's not an avoidable thing | 18:05:57 |
Grimmauld (any/all) | so let me keep track:
- maliit bad but a fix is in sight
- LLVM/mesa maybe fixable by static and/or moving some stuff
- samba/python cursed
| 18:08:47 |
Grimmauld (any/all) | * so let me keep track:
- maliit bad but a fix is in sight
- LLVM/mesa maybe fixable by static and/or moving some stuff
- samba/python cursed
- sdl/gtk not worth trying to optimize
| 18:08:59 |
emily | the Samba thing is probably not hard if I had to guess | 18:10:02 |
emily | they'll have been using Python's binding to MD5 or whatever for some cursed SMB thing in the tool | 18:10:15 |
emily | just need to check if they're still doing that | 18:10:22 |
Grimmauld (any/all) | the codebase is a mess | 18:10:33 |
Grimmauld (any/all) | its basically one giant python file they call into as a library | 18:10:43 |
K900 | Maliit is not getting fixed | 18:10:44 |
K900 | To be clear | 18:10:45 |
Grimmauld (any/all) | replace is a kind of fix for us | 18:10:56 |